Apply for a Moneyback loan via the internet and you may borrow any amount from £3,000 - £20,000 over a repayment period between 12 months and five years. Your monthly repayments are fixed for the period of the loan. You must be at least 18 years of age to borrow money from Moneyback Bank.

The loan is designed to appeal to a young, online audience who are happy to transact completely online and adopt a 'self-service' approach to their finances. However, what makes the Moneyback loan different is, as the name suggests, the prospect of getting some of your money back.

Customers who take out the optional loan protection insurance are eligible for a no claims bonus totalling up to £350. The amount of the no claims bonus increases on a sliding scale dependant on the size and term of the loan. Those borrowing £1,000 - £4,999 would receive £10 a year while those borrowing £20,001 - £25,000 would receive £50 a year no claims bonus.

The Moneyback payment will be paid on the anniversary of the loan into the account from which your monthly direct debit repayment is taken. It will be paid each year providing you have not cancelled or claimed on the loan protection and have not missed a monthly payment on your loan.

The Moneyback loan does not offer the option of any repayment holidays and if you repay the loan early, you may face an interest penalty for doing so.

The Moneyback loan is a low rate personal loan from Moneyback Bank, which was launched as a trading name of Alliance & Leicester in June 2005. Moneyback Bank offers internet-only products to customers who know what they want and who are happy to complete all their transactions online without help, advice or phone support.

Alliance & Leicester has been around in one guise or another since 1852. in 1990 it purchased Girobank and thus became the first building society to run a clearing bank. Alliance & Leicester itself became a bank, listing shares on the stock market in April 1997.
